How to fill out the UPS Bill of Lading online

Filling out the UPS Bill of Lading online can streamline your shipping process, ensuring all necessary information is accurately captured.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to help you complete the form effectively.

Follow the steps to successfully complete the UPS Bill of Lading online.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to access the UPS Bill of Lading and open it in your preferred editing tool.
  2. In the 'Ship From' section, enter the name, address, city, state, zip code, and SID# of the sender.
  3. Assign a unique Bill of Lading Number and fill in the FOB details.
  4. Complete the 'Ship To' section by entering the recipient's name, address, city, state, and zip code.
  5. Input the carrier name, location number, trailer number, seal number(s), SCAC, and pro number in the respective fields.
  6. If third party freight charges will apply, fill in the third-party billing information in the designated area.
  7. Indicate the freight charge terms: check the 'Prepaid' box if applicable and add any special instructions.
  8. Provide the customer order number, number of packages, and any relevant customer order information.
  9. List the weight and handling unit details, ensuring to mark any special commodities that need extra attention.
  10. Complete the 'Grand Total' section indicating any COD amounts and applicable fee terms.
  11. Obtain the shipper's signature along with the date to certify that all details provided are correct and compliant with regulations.
  12. Finally, review your completed form for accuracy, save your changes, and choose to download, print, or share the document as needed.

A Bill of Lading is a legal document between a shipper and carrier detailing the type, quantity, and destination of goods. For example, when shipping furniture, the UPS Bill of Lading would list the items, their condition, and the recipient’s address. This document protects both parties and acts as proof of shipment.
